作者投稿和查稿 主编审稿 专家审稿 编委审稿 远程编辑

计算机工程 ›› 2006, Vol. 32 ›› Issue (18): 52-54,6. doi: 10.3969/j.issn.1000-3428.2006.18.019

• 软件技术与数据库 • 上一篇    下一篇

基于并行状态自动机的工作流建模

刘惊雷,张 伟,范宝德   

  1. (烟台大学计算机学院,烟台 264005)
  • 收稿日期:1900-01-01 修回日期:1900-01-01 出版日期:2006-09-20 发布日期:2006-09-20

Workflow Modeling Based on Parallel Finite Automata

LIU Jinglei, ZHANG Wei, Fan Baode   

  1. (Department of Computer Science, Yantai University, Yantai 264005)
  • Received:1900-01-01 Revised:1900-01-01 Online:2006-09-20 Published:2006-09-20

摘要: 为了实现工作流管理功能,首先要把业务过程从现实世界抽象出来,并用一种形式化方法对其进行描述,其结果就是工作流模型。该文讨论利用并行自动机对工作流的形式化问题。基于对工作流和并行自动机的分析,提出了将工作流的概念映射到并行自动机概念上的方法,该方法可以把工作流联盟提出的工作流的4种结构映射到并行自动机的结构上。给出了并行自动机的结点转化图,即给出了工作流引擎的框架。并行自动机是一种图形的、数学化的计算模型,当工作流的模型——并行自动机建立起来后,为工作流的静态特性和动态特性的分析打下不坚实的基础,为进一步的研究作好了准备。

关键词: 工作流模型, 形式化方法, 工作流引擎, 并行自动机, 计算模型

Abstract: To achieve the function of workflow management, the business process must be abstracted from the real world and described by a kind of formal method. The result is workflow model. This paper discusses workflow models and their formal descriptions using parallel finite automata(PFA)theory. Based on the analysis of workflow and PFA, it proposes the method of mapping workflow management concepts onto PFA, and this method can map four types of routing constructs advocated by WfMC onto the structure of PFA. An executing process description of PFA is given, that is, a framework of workflow engineer is given. Because PFA is a graphics and mathematics computing model, after PFA has been built up, it has grounded for the analysis of workflow static and dynamic characteristic, thus makes the preparation for the further research.

Key words: Workflow model, Formal method, Workflow engine, Parallel automata, Computing model